# HG changeset patch # User Bram Moolenaar # Date 1611254706 -3600 # Node ID e7f5931b46ca9e7e3257ef022ae1a9248f8ac08f # Parent 915625fad6099da920ef079440dc3408c9e4b482 patch 8.2.2386: Vim9: crash when using ":silent! put"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/f904133e1a5ea84a124d3ece12b1f0a7392f1ca7 Author: Bram Moolenaar Date: Thu Jan 21 19:41:16 2021 +0100 patch 8.2.2386: Vim9: crash when using ":silent! put" Problem: Vim9: crash when using ":silent! put". Solution: When ignoring an error for ":silent!" rewind the stack and skip ahead to restoring the cmdmod.
